How can a college tutor near me at Johns Hopkins University help me study?
College classes differ in many ways from their high school counterparts. For example, they often move at a quicker pace, cover more challenging material, and offer fewer opportunities for one-on-one assistance. Add this to the number of courses that a typical college student takes each semester and it's clear just how difficult it can be to make academic progress in a collegiate learning environment. However, you don't have to go through these difficulties alone.
Instead, you can get started with Johns Hopkins University tutoring. Your instructor can supplement the work that you've been doing in the classroom to help you make more efficient progress towards your goals. They can create a customized lesson plan for you, which focuses on the material that you need the most assistance with. Your Johns Hopkins tutor can help you with a wide range of subjects, including chemistry, physics, calculus, the liberal arts, and much more.
You'll be able to work through your customized lesson plan at the pace that's right for you. This differs from the traditional classroom setting where you need to move through topics at the pace that's determined by your professor. Being able to work at your own pace allows you to spend as much or as little time as you need on each topic. It also enables your instructor to provide you with all of the support that you need to fully understand each topic before moving to the next one. This type of personalization in the learning process is key to what makes working with a Johns Hopkins University tutor such an excellent addition to your studies.
Can a college tutor at Johns Hopkins University help my study for an exam?
One of the most difficult parts of college is the midterms and finals that you'll have to take in many of your classes. These are often comprehensive, which means that you'll have to answer questions on everything that you've learned throughout the year in a single exam. It can be hard to create a test preparation plan that successfully prepares you for these challenging exams on your own.
That's why working with a Johns Hopkins tutor can also be an excellent way to prepare for your upcoming exams. A private instructor can help you create and work through a study plan that covers everything that you need to know for your test. They can provide you with sample problems to work through under their guidance and use a number of other impactful test preparation methodologies to help you get ready for your exam. Your instructor can even show you test-taking strategies that you can utilize to become more efficient at answering questions on timed exams. The assistance that you get through Johns Hopkins tutoring can help you increase the quality of each of your study sessions because of these factors.
